Imaging Above Everything
The DJI Mavic 3 sets a new standard for aerial imaging.
The Mavic 2’s L2D-20c camera was specifically designed by Hasselblad for this drone. Alongside the ability to capture 20-megapixel aerial images, the Mavic 3 features a 4/3 CMOS sensor which captures images at a higher dynamic range and facilitates better low-light performance. This drone records 5.1K videos to provide breath-taking, highly detailed footage.
With up to 46 minutes of flight time, users no longer have to worry about missing the perfect shot due to low battery. Despite the compact nature of this drone, its durability is impressive. The Mavic 3 can withstand winds of 12m/s and has a transmission range of up to 15km.
Fly with confidence with the enhanced safety features of this drone including omnidirectional obstacle sensing, APAS 5.0 and Advanced Return to Home.
The intelligent flight modes of this drone include MasterShots, QuickShots and ActiveTrack 5.0.

Specifications
Weight | 895 g |
Dimensions | 221 x 96.3 x 90.3 mm (folded without propellers) 347.5 x 283 x 107.7 mm (unfolded without propellers) |
Diagonal Length | 380.1 mm |
Max Ascent Speed | 8 m/s (S Mode) 6 m/s (N Mode) 1 m/s (C Mode) |
Max Descent Speed | 6 m/s (S Mode) 6 m/s (N Mode) 1 m/s (C Mode) |
Max Speed | 19 m/s (S Mode) 15 m/s (N Mode) 5 m/s (C Mode) |
Max Service Ceiling | 6000 m |
Max Flight Time | 46 mins |
Camera Quality | 20 MP 4/3 CMOS |
Video Quality | 5.1K/50fps |
